Which of the following should be done prior to pin hole placement in an extensive amalgam preparation?
1. Examine the radiograph.
2. Determine the subgingival anatomic contours.
3. Remove caries and unsupported enamel.
4. Place a pilot hole at the dentinoenamel junction.
(1) (2) (3)
